The Panola County Groundwater Conservation District was created in 2007 by the 80th Texas Legislature with a directive to conserve, protect and enhance the groundwater resources of Panola County.  On November 6, 2007, the citizens of Panola County approved the formation of the District to protect and monitor the aquifer resources within the District.
The District is committed to managing and protecting the groundwater resources within its jurisdiction and to work with other stake holders to ensure a sustainable, high quality and cost effective supply of water for future generations.  The District will strive to develop, promote, and implement water conservation and management strategies to protect water resources for the benefit of the citizens, economy and environment of the District.  The preservation of this most valuable resource can be managed in a prudent and cost effective manner through conservation, education, management, and through rule implementation. Any action taken by the District shall be upon full consideration and deference to the individual property rights of the citizens residing in the District.

Panola County, is a county located in the U.S. state of Texas. The county seat is Carthage. Located in East Texas and originally developed for cotton plantations, the county's name is derived from a Choctaw word for cotton.

Panola Orchard and Gardens is owned by long-time farmer, John Alexander, and his wife Judy. John has been in the farming industry since 1971, and began specializing in blueberries in 1992.  
After starting a successful commercial blueberry business, John received the Entrepreneur of the Year Award in 1997.
In 2005, John and Judy took a break from farming and enjoyed retirement; however, John began missing the work he had done for so many years.  
Their daughter and son-in-law, Brenda and Jason Martin, had an interest in farming as well, so in 2011, Panola Orchard and Gardens was established in De Berry, Texas. We wanted to be able to offer our customers a variety of fruits, so we decided to expand our crops. Our largest crop is blueberries! We have 90 acres of blueberries that is picked by a commercial harvester, sorted, packaged, and shipped in the United States. We also have an additional 5 acre blueberry U-Pick field.  
We have 22 acres of peach trees and one acre of plum trees. Each year we plant approximately 100,000 strawberry plants for customers to pick. Our newest addition to our farm is Christmas trees. We grow and sell leyland cypress trees. We offer "you choose, we cut" or you can cut your own tree down using one of our saws.
We have a 2300 square foot, air conditioned Farm Store where customers can get their buckets for picking berries, pick out their selection of our homegrown peaches, plums, and vegetables; shop for preserves, salsa, and many more gourmet food items; or cool off with a lemonade or ice cream.
